Choosing a Halloween Color Palette for Your Workspace
When you’re picking a Halloween color palette for your workspace, think about how certain hues can evoke the season’s spooky spirit.
Start with classic colors like orange, black, and purple. Orange brings warmth and excitement, while black adds a touch of mystery. Purple can introduce a whimsical, magical feel that complements the theme perfectly.
You might also consider hints of green, reminiscent of ghoulish creatures, or deep reds for a more sinister vibe.
Mix these colors through your desk accessories, wall art, and even your stationery. Remember, the key is balance; you want your space to feel festive without overwhelming your productivity.
A thoughtfully curated palette can truly enhance your workspace’s Halloween atmosphere while keeping you inspired.

Adding a Touch of Halloween With Scent and Sound
While you might be focused on your tasks, adding scent and sound can instantly immerse you in the Halloween spirit.
Consider lighting a pumpkin spice or cinnamon-scented candle; these warm, inviting aromas evoke the essence of the season. If candles aren’t your thing, opt for essential oil diffusers with spooky scents like clove or nutmeg.
For sound, create a playlist of eerie background music or classic Halloween-themed tunes. You can even play ambient sounds like rustling leaves or distant howls to enhance the atmosphere.
Just a few subtle additions can transform your workspace into a festive haven. Embrace these sensory elements to make your cubicle not just a place of work, but a celebration of Halloween!

How Do I Ensure My Decorations Are Workspace-Friendly?
To ensure your decorations are workspace-friendly, stick to non-intrusive items, avoid strong scents, and keep visibility clear. Choose lightweight, removable decorations that won’t damage surfaces, so you can easily switch back to your regular setup.
